    Do people usually prefer a square back or a round back hardcover book?

    Does it only come down to aesthetics, or are there any functional/practical concerns involved with square back (where there is a board in the spline of the case binding) or round back hardbound books?

    Prefer a board in the spine. Less creep with square back and it stays nice and "square" over time.

    Generally, rounded back can open flattly than square back but the cost is more expensive.
